首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从天气api获取数据并访问它的数据

从天气API获取数据并访问其数据,可以通过以下步骤实现:

  1. 了解天气API:天气API是一种提供天气数据的接口,可以通过发送HTTP请求获取天气相关信息,如温度、湿度、风速等。不同的天气API提供不同的数据格式和访问方式。
  2. 注册并获取API密钥:访问天气API通常需要注册并获取API密钥,以验证你的身份和授权你的访问权限。具体的注册和获取API密钥的步骤可以参考天气API提供商的文档。
  3. 选择合适的编程语言和开发环境:根据你的喜好和熟悉程度,选择一种合适的编程语言和开发环境进行开发。常见的编程语言如Python、Java、JavaScript等都可以用来访问天气API。
  4. 发送HTTP请求获取数据:使用选择的编程语言和相应的HTTP库,构建一个HTTP请求,包括API的URL、请求方法(通常是GET)、请求头和参数。将API密钥作为参数添加到请求中,以验证你的访问权限。
  5. 解析和处理返回的数据:发送HTTP请求后,会收到一个响应,其中包含天气API返回的数据。根据API提供商的文档,了解返回数据的格式和结构,使用相应的数据解析库对返回的数据进行解析和处理。
  6. 使用天气数据:一旦成功获取和解析天气数据,你可以根据自己的需求进行进一步处理和应用。例如,可以将数据展示在网页上、存储到数据库中、与其他数据进行分析等。

在腾讯云的产品中,可以使用腾讯云的API网关(API Gateway)来管理和发布天气API,使用腾讯云的云函数(Cloud Function)来处理和解析返回的数据,使用腾讯云的对象存储(Object Storage)来存储和管理天气数据。具体的产品介绍和文档可以参考腾讯云官方网站。

请注意,以上答案仅供参考,具体的实现方式和推荐的产品取决于你的需求和实际情况。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Android 天气APP(三)访问天气API数据请求

访问天气API数据请求 2. 访问天气API接口 3....访问天气API接口 这里用是和风天气API接口,点击进入官网 点击天气API进行登录控制台或者注册账号 注册用邮箱就可以了,这里没有什么好讲解,我是已经注册过了,所以我登录就可以了,...点击创建 接下来我们看一下开发文档怎么去获取天气数据 点击常规天气数据,免费版 now就是今天天气,根据这个文档我们来写一个访问地址 https://free-api.heweather.net...网络请求 通过上面的访问地址,我们可以看得出来,只要修改location值就可以得到不同地方天气数据信息了,刚才是在网页上访问,接下来就通过Android来访问这个地址,得到数据并且显示出来。...//获取今天天气数据 private void getTodayWeather(String district) { //使用Get异步请求 OkHttpClient

2.5K20

在线请求天气API解析其中json数据予以显示

Android网络与数据存储 第二章学习 ---- 在线请求天气API解析其中json数据予以显示#### 概要: 请求互联网信息提供商取得返回数据使用到HttpURLConnection,...等待数据下载成功得到Json,把 解析成程序可利用数据,使用到JSONObject ---- 使用和风天气API作为范例,只要注册就可免费用还凑合天气预报平台 http://www.heweather.com...时,HttpClient已经彻底SDK里消失了,虽然是个重要类,包括如今阿里云服务中,也依然给我们提供了基于HttpClientAPI请求SDK,由于版本问题,我也难以使用。...cityid=城市ID&key=你认证key” 这种就是GET POST: 这个则可以在请求实体内容中向服务器发送数据,传输没有数量限制 2.定制HttpURLConnection获取链接状态:...此时,完成了一系列操作后,我们取得了网络返回数据

5.9K41

C# 实现访问 Web API Url 提交数据获取处理结果

应用场景 应用程序编程接口(Application Programming Interface,简称:API),是服务方定制开发一些预先定义函数方法,并提供访问方式及规则。...访问 API 开发人员无需理解其内部工作机制,只根据服务方提供说明及规则,提交参数数据获取有需要处理结果。 Web API 是 Web 服务器和 Web 浏览器之间应用程序处理接口。...我们常见模式是访问 Web API Url 地址,POST 或 GET 所需要参数数据获取 Json 、XML或其它指定格式处理结果。...GetResponseResult 方法提供了访问 Web API Url 能力,方法返回字符串(即API返回处理结果),另外WebService 类还提供了 ErrorMessage 属性,通过访问此属性是否为空以判断方法是否正确返回了处理结果...outstream.Write(data, 0, data.Length); outstream.Close(); //发送请求获取相应回应数据

8710

ESP8266获取天气预报信息,使用CJSON解析天气预报数据

一、实现功能 当前文章介绍如何使用ESP8266和STM32微控制器,搭配OLED显示屏,制作一个能够实时显示天气预报智能设备。...将使用心知天气API获取天气数据使用MQTT协议将数据传递给STM32控制器,最终在OLED显示屏上显示。...心知天气是一家专业气象数据服务提供商,致力于为全球用户提供高质量、定制化气象数据服务。其主要产品包括天气API、空气质量API、灾害预警API等。...用户可以通过心知天气API接口,获取准确、实时天气数据,从而为各种应用场景提供支持,例如智能家居、出行、电商等。...ESP8266模块 ESP8266是一款WiFi模块,具有强大网络连接功能,可以轻松地连接到互联网。将使用ESP8266模块来获取天气数据,并将其发送给STM32控制器。

1.2K40

历史天气预报 API 看气象大数据商业价值

引言近年来,随着气象观测技术不断提升和气象大数据快速发展,越来越多企业开始将气象数据应用于商业领域。其中,历史天气预报 API 作为一种可获取历史气象数据接口,具有广泛商业应用价值。...本文将从历史天气预报 API 商业应用角度出发,探讨气象大数据在商业领域中价值和作用,探讨实现一个气象预警系统设计思路应该考虑什么。...为气象科研提供数据支持历史天气预报 API 可以提供多年气象数据,这些数据可以为气象科研提供数据支持。...设计一个农业气象预警系统需要考虑以下几个方面:图片API 获取步骤进入 APISpace 页面,根据以下步骤即可成功获取。...而在当今信息时代,API 无疑是一种非常有价值资源,如果我们能够掌握如何使用它们思维,就可以开拓出更多应用场景和商业机会。

42910

中国天气api接口调用,key获取方式,数据请求秘钥获取,城市id获取方法

以前天气获取方式已经不支持了,虽然能获取数据,但是获取信息已经不对了。 中国天气网提供最新接口需要数据请求秘钥key。...而且有效期只有7天,用完了还要重新购买,很麻烦,但是获取内容绝对是最全,最专业。 所以还是为大家介绍一下中国天气网接口调用。...申请数据请求秘钥key 地址:中国天气网-智慧云服务平台 需要先注册登录。 然后在"数据云-组合套餐-免费体验版立即体验"获取key。 ? ?...获取key可以在右上角"我是买家-我订单-套餐-接口详情"进行查看。 ? 最新api接口调用 最新接口调用方法可以在首页帮助进行查看。 ? 使用说明里有接口调用方法。 ?...城市id获取方法: 直接在中国天气网官网搜索北京天气,地址就有对应id。 ? 使用方法: http://api.weatherdt.com/common/?

4.3K31

天气数据宝库:解锁天气预报API无限可能性

然而,要提供准确天气预报,需要庞大数据集和复杂计算模型。这就是天气预报API价值所在。天气API:数百万数据精华在过去,获取准确天气数据是一项繁琐任务。...然而,随着气象科学进步和数字技术崭露头角,天气API已经解决了这个问题。它们是数字时代宝库,提供了数百万数据精华,可用于各种应用。1.实时数据更新一项天气API关键功能是实时数据更新。...用户可以轻松地获取当前天气状况,包括温度、湿度、气压、风速和风向等信息。这对于日常生活中决策非常重要。您是否应该穿外套?是否需要带雨伞?这些问题答案可以通过天气API得出。...2.未来预测天气API还提供了未来几天或几周天气预测。这些预测是通过复杂气象模型生成,考虑了多种因素,如大气压力、湿度、风向和海洋温度。...3.如何使用以 APISpace 为例,注册登录接口平台,申请天气预报查询接口然后进行 API 测试,输入城市编码,即可获取该城市详细天气信息。

21820

(译) 如何使用 React hooks 获取 api 接口数据

如果你想查看完整的如何使用 React Hooks 获取数据项目代码,可以查看 github 仓库 如果你只是想用 React Hooks 进行数据获取,直接 npm i use-data-api...它将引导您完成使用React类组件数据获取如何使用Render Prop 组件和高阶组件来复用这些数据,以及如何处理错误以及 loading 。...在这个代码里面,我们使用 async/await 去获取第三方 API 接口数据,根据文档,每一个 async 都会返回一个 promise:async 函数声明定义了一个异步函数,返回一个 AsyncFunction...但是,如果你对错误处理、loading、如何触发表单中获取数据或者如何实现可重用数据获取钩子。请继续阅读。 如何自动或者手动触发 hook?...目前我们已经通过组件第一次加载时候获取了接口数据。但是,如何能够通过输入字段来告诉 api 接口我对那个主题感兴趣呢?(就是怎么给接口传数据

28.4K20

如何用R和API免费获取Web数据

API是获得Web数据重要途径之一。想不想了解如何用R调用API,提取和整理你需要免费Web数据呢?本文一步步为你详尽展示操作流程。 ?...作者还在不断整理修订,你可以把收藏起来,慢慢看。 ? 如果我们得知某个网站提供API,并且通过看说明文档,知道了我们需要数据就在其中,那问题就变成了——该如何通过API来获得数据呢?...,以及包含其他元数据,都正确地服务器用API反馈给了我们。...作为一部30多年前剧集,今天还不断有人访问其维基页面,可见魅力。图中可以非常明显看到几个峰值,你能解释它们出现原因吗?这将作为今天另外一道习题,供你思考。...小结 简单回顾一下,本文我们接触到了以下重要知识点: 获取Web数据三种常见方式及其应用场景; 常见API目录资源获取地址和使用方法; 如何用R来调用API,并且服务器反馈结果中抽取关心数据

2.1K20

python如何获取数据做可视化分析

疫情期间时候分享了如何利用python爬虫疫情数据博客,今天我们同样操作来获取下现在甲流感染数据 爬取思路以下几个方面进行分析,数据来源于:https://www.baidu.com/ 1、分析网页网络数据...2、分析解析出包,进行提取和操作 3、将数据提出并存到数据库 涉及到知识点:python爬取,目标网站反爬 思路差不多就是这些,因为有反爬,所以在爬取过程中错了反爬措施,基本就是解决方案就是User-Agent...用户代理添加和代理使用,加上User-Agent,表明你是浏览器访问即可。...爬虫如何添加UA: class ProxyMiddleware(object): def process_request(self...8&f=8&rsv_bp=1&rsv_idx=1&tn=baidu&wd=nike'} response = requests.get(url=url, headers=headers) cookie获取

45260

比较两次接口获取数据找出变动字段

0}],请问再次请求这个接口时候如何获取数据和上一次获取数据进行比较,找出变动字段。...解析: 要比较两次接口获取数据找出变动字段,你可以按照以下步骤进行: 存储上一次数据:首先,你需要有一个地方来存储上一次接口获取数据。这可以是一个变量、数据库或任何其他存储机制。...获取数据:当你再次调用接口时,你将获得一组新数据。 比较数据:将新数据与旧数据进行比较,以找出任何变动字段。...以下是一个简化JavaScript示例,展示了如何执行此操作: // 假设这是上一次接口获取数据 let previousData = [ {Id:1,pending:65,queued...:0,completed:0}, {Id:2,pending:0,queued:0,completed:0} ]; // 假设这是新接口获取数据 let newData

7010

k8sailor - 08 使用 vue 获取后台 API 数据展示

/httpc' // 获取所有 deployment 信息 // namespace 默认值为 defualt // 使用 async await 解析内容 async function getAllDeployments...由于目前 前后端 是分离,并且之前我们在 server 并没有相关代码允许跨域请求。所有通过页面的请求 暂时 是无法拿到数据。...https://v3.vuejs.org/guide/composition-api-lifecycle-hooks.html import {reactive...-- 省略 --> 使用 v-if 进行条件渲染 在返回数据中, 有两种状况: 有错误, 没数据 没错误, 有数据 因此设置了两个容器(错误与表格), 使用 v-if 根据是否有错误消息决定是否展示这两部分容器...-- 省略 --> 使用 v-model 绑定数据 v-model 数据双向绑定。

1.1K20

Android 垃圾分类APP(一)申请API、搭建项目、访问接口获取数据

APP最重要是什么?是数据,任何APP操作都是数据,只不过形式各不相同,那么垃圾分类数据什么地方来呢。...网络上有很多API数据提供商,例如聚合、天行等,这里我将使用天行API,可能会有第一次看博客朋友,不过我也是第一次写这个垃圾分类APP,因此我们都从头开始吧。...一、申请垃圾分类API 首先注册账号,点击天行数据API进入主页。 朴实无华主页,右上角那里就是登录和立即注册,点击立即注册。 这里就是填写基本信息,没啥好说。...先来配置网络访问环境,第一个就是http访问许可,Android9.0之后默认使用https访问网络,而这个垃圾分类接口是http格式,因此先增加许可。...三、访问API接口 可以在MainActivity中写一个这样方法,通过使用Okhttp来请求API接口,这里使用是Get请求,也都是常规代码。由于变化只有物品,因此作为入参传进来。

1.3K30

如何正确获取数据

作者 | Will Koehrsen 翻译 | Lemon 出品 | Python数据之道 (ID:PyDataRoad) 如何正确获得数据?...毫不奇怪,在获取大量触手可及资源情况下,我最终获得了成功,并且在此过程中我学到了一些关于数据科学所需“其他”熟练技能,我已在下面列出。...图4: 始终注意阅读细节 虽然我已经尝试过这个来源,但我回到了门户网站决定联系页面提出请求。...Step 5: 分享 虽然这个项目从技术上来说是 Kaggle 上一个竞赛项目,但我无法保密这些数据可用性。 我立即建立了一个讨论小组共享了数据链接。...这意味着当你发现一些有趣东西时,不要把留给自己,而是分享,以便其他人也可以学习! Kaggle 其他数据科学家那里收到了很多东西后,能够给予一点回报感觉很棒。

3.4K20

前端如何在线Mock数据生成API接口文档

在我们项目里,前后端分离目前是符合当下趋势,在过去前后端不分离时代已经变成过去式,在实际项目开发中,在前期我们如何不依赖真实接口而Mock一份真实接口数据呢?...开始第一个例子 在以前我们可以借助EazyMock[1]在线创建接口数据,在大多时候这是我们首选,简单,方便,并提供了非常好mock接口工具,但是笔者想介绍另外一个比较好用在线mock工具,apipost...[2] 首先我们登录控制台后,我们新建一个项目 我们新建一个test-demo项目后 我们新建一个商品列表接口,接口路由暂定/api/shoplist 我们在设计上,并且选择Mock环境,并且在200...中提供了一份非常强大自定生成接口文档功能 编辑以下,然后点击保存 我们点击分享 当我们复制打开这个链接时api/shoplist[3] 此时你会发现自动生成文档结构非常清晰,因此在项目中,你可以完全不依赖后端接口...总结 我们使用apipost新建一个项目,新建了一个测试接口,实时mock了一份在线数据 我们在实际页面中,测试了apipost新建接口数据,并且成功响应 我们根据现有的接口,在线生成了一份MOCK

95920
领券